Business AnalyseSystemanalytiker

Wie überprüft und validiert ein Systemanalytiker Anforderungen? Beschreiben Sie den Abstimmungs- und Validierungsprozess der Anforderungen in allen Phasen des Projekts.

Bestehen Sie Vorstellungsgespräche mit dem Hintsage-KI-Assistenten

Antwort.

Die Überprüfung, Validierung und Abstimmung von Anforderungen ist ein kontinuierlicher Prozess während des gesamten Projekts. Der Systemanalytiker muss sicherstellen, dass die Anforderungen:

  • Vollständig und konsistent sind
  • Technisch umsetzbar und der Geschäftslogik entsprechen
  • Für alle Beteiligten klar verständlich sind

Der Prozess der Validierung der Anforderungen umfasst:

  • Gemeinsame Reviews mit dem Geschäft (Workshops, Demos, Interviews)
  • Abstimmung der Anforderungen mit Architekten und dem Entwicklungsteam
  • Nachverfolgbarkeit der Anforderungen bis zu Aufgaben, Tests und Releases (Traceability)
  • Verwendung von Akzeptanzkriterien (Acceptance Criteria), Testfällen (Test Cases)
  • Erhalt einer formalen Bestätigung (Unterschriften, Kommentare, Status "genehmigt")

Anforderungen können in jeder Phase des Produktlebenszyklus aktualisiert oder ergänzt werden; es ist wichtig, ihre Relevanz zu erhalten und sie bei Änderungen zu korrigieren.

Fangfragen.

Änderungen der Anforderungen nach der Abstimmung sind nicht erlaubt?

Das ist falsch. Änderungen der Geschäftsziele oder technischen Bedingungen können kontinuierliche Updates der Anforderungen erfordern.

Reicht es aus, die Anforderungen nur aus geschäftlicher Sicht zu validieren?

Nein. Es ist wichtig, die Anforderungen auch aus technischer Sicht hinsichtlich der Umsetzbarkeit und der Einhaltung architektonischer Vorgaben abzustimmen.

Akzeptanzkriterien (Acceptance Criteria) gelten nur für User Stories?

Nein. Akzeptanzkriterien sind für alle Arten von Anforderungen gültig, um die Korrektheit ihrer Umsetzung zu prüfen.

Typische Fehler und Anti-Patterns

  • Fehlende formale Akzeptanzkriterien ("funktioniert, wenn keine Fehler auftreten")
  • Ignorieren von Feedback des Entwicklungsteams bei der Ausarbeitung der Anforderungen
  • Fehlendes Feedback zu implementierten Anforderungen (Retrospektiven, Demos)

Beispiel aus dem Leben

Negativer Fall: Der Analyst sendet die Anforderungen zur Abstimmung nur an das Geschäft, ohne sie mit den Entwicklern zu besprechen. In der finalen Umsetzung treten große technische Schwierigkeiten auf, und einige Anforderungen stellen sich als unmöglich heraus. Vorteile: Zeitersparnis bei Diskussionen — Nachteile: Viele Nachbearbeitungen, Zeitverlust, Verzögerung des Projekts.

Positiver Fall: Die Anforderungen werden sowohl von der Geschäftseite als auch vom technischen Team überprüft, alle Kommentare werden dokumentiert, Akzeptanzkriterien werden erstellt, und die Anforderungen werden in der Demo von allen Seiten akzeptiert. Vorteile: Minimiere Missverständnisse, Sicherheit in der Umsetzbarkeit — Nachteile: Mehr Zeit für Vorbereitung und Abstimmung.